Most Popular Indiana Schools for a Master's in Geography & Cartography
Our analysis found Indiana University - Bloomington to be the most popular school for geography and cartography students who want to pursue a master’s degree in Indiana. Located in the city of Bloomington, IU Bloomington is a public school with a fairly large student population.

A rank of #2 on this year’s list means Indiana University - Purdue University - Indianapolis is a great place for geography and cartography students working on their master’s degree. IUPUI is a very large public school located in the large city of Indianapolis.
About 33% of the students majoring in geography at the school are women while 67% are male.
